Vendor note: Pipershaw handles notification fan-out for the Orlin platform. Their ingestion applies backpressure above 5k events/sec per tenant; our dispatcher must respect their 429s and back off exponentially, not retry hot. Contract renewal is Q3; throughput tiers are negotiated annually, so don't promise clients higher limits. Any sustained throttling should be logged and reported weekly. For quota changes or incident coordination, go through our vendor liaison.

escalation mailbox, yajeg-bageg: quenax.olidor@lumiccorp.internal

# Gatecount Environments

Welcome! Gatecount tallies turnstile spins at Harrowfield Arena. We run two environments: "match-day" (live gates) and "quiet" (a replay rig fed from recorded spins). Always test against quiet first — nobody wants phantom attendance numbers on a derby night. Both environments share the same binary but differ only in config. The quiet rig currently runs with these settings.

service settings:
PRAIX_LOG_LEVEL=error
PRAIX_METRICS_HOST=metrics.praix.qorvelcorp.corp
PRAIX_POOL_SIZE=16

Briefing – Leadership Review, Kestrel Systems

Pilot with Braywick Stores: 14 locations live, 9 weeks in. Shelf-scan accuracy at 96%, above target. Staff adoption strong; two sites lagging on training. Braywick signals intent to expand to 60 stores if pricing holds. Risks: hardware lead times, one unresolved data-retention clause. Recommendation: proceed to contract negotiation, cap pilot spend at current level. Fuller commercial context for the board follows below.

board note of yadup-fajef: Druiusox Holdings is in early talks to buy Norwynek Systems for about $186.0 million. The Kaseth launch date is June 24, and nothing goes to the press before then. Legal wants the Quenethek Group term sheet withdrawn before November 27.

Ticket: Signature verification failed on ScrubShot plugin upload

Your EXIF-scrubbing plugin (version 2.4.1) was rejected by the Pixelmere marketplace because the package signature did not match our records. This usually happens when a plugin is rebuilt after the manifest was signed, or when an outdated key was used. Please rebuild, re-sign with the current marketplace key, and resubmit. Unsigned or mismatched packages are quarantined automatically after three failures. For convenience, the key currently accepted by the verifier is listed here.

rollout seal: bky4_x7Gc